Transaction 76cbf86068a58cdc2e2fd7901a51929ec1a8bb48203db75530456c0e2175e307
1 Input
1 Output
-
76cbf86068a58cdc2e2fd7901a51929ec1a8bb48203db75530456c0e2175e307:0
- value
- 26577555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d113ad2f06a5651fab453b1a59ea51c9fe1d686f OP_EQUAL
- address
- 3LkWinPfcX7gutjbA1pA8ZYC8roKvBCkxW